What is the F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form?
The F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form is essential for students at City College of San Francisco to establish their eligibility for federal financial aid. This form serves specifically to confirm the status of students who are categorized as orphans, foster care recipients, or wards of the court, thereby helping them access the financial assistance they qualify for.
By validating their circumstances using this form, students ensure compliance with federal funding requirements, which can significantly impact their educational opportunities.

Who Needs the F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form?
The F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form is required for students who meet specific criteria, including being an orphan, a foster care recipient, or a ward of the court. To qualify as an orphan, a student must provide documentation proving the death of one or both parents.
Additionally, students under foster care need evidence of their current status, ensuring they can prove their eligibility for federal financial aid. Understanding these criteria is vital for those who wish to access financial support for their education.
Required Documents and Supporting Materials
Students must submit several documents to validate their status when filling out the F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form. Essential documents can include:
-
Death certificates
-
Court decrees
-
Verification from the Department of Human Services
-
Any relevant legal documents
Providing these materials is crucial for ensuring the verification process proceeds smoothly, helping to secure financial aid effectively.

Who is eligible to complete the F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form?
The form is designed for students who are orphans, foster care recipients, or wards of the court, specifically those seeking financial aid at City College of San Francisco.
Are there any deadlines for submitting this form?
Students should check with City College of San Francisco for specific deadlines regarding the submission of the FAFSA Orphan Foster Care Verification Form, as adherence to these deadlines is crucial for financial aid consideration.
What documents do I need to submit with the form?
You will need supporting documents like death certificates, court decrees, or verification letters from the Department of Human Services to validate your status as an orphan or foster care recipient.
